Web27 jul. 2024 · Non-compete clauses need to include “consideration,” which is a legal term meaning there is some exchange of value. In other words, your employee needs to get something worthwhile out of it. WebIn creating a Non-Compete Clause, you will need to provide the following information: The names and addresses of the parties involved (both the Protected Party, or the party requesting the agreement and the Noncompeting Party, or the party who is being prohibited from working for a competitor) The effective date and the duration of the agreement

WebFor a non-compete agreement to be legally enforceable, it must meet several qualifications: The agreement must protect a legitimate business interest. The scope and length of the agreement should be reasonable. The agreement must be in line with the public interest. If the agreement has no consideration, then it is seen as unenforceable.
